National Hotline for Substance Abuse and Mental Health

If you or someone you know is struggling with mental health or substance abuse issues, please consider contacting the SAMHSA National Helpline. This confidential, free service offers assistance 24/7 and can link you to local resources.

The number is straightforward : 1-800-662-HELP (4357). You can also visit their website at https://www.samhsa.gov/find-help/national-helpline for more information.
